    These were custom built O/U brocock cartridge shotguns. The bores were 10mm for firing cardboard tubes of shot that were screwed onto the TAC in place of the nosecone. The bore(s) could be sleeved with .177/.22 barrels for firing air cartridges in the usual manner, so you could have say, a shotgun for the lower barrel and a .22 pellet in the top one. These are obviously illegal now unless already registered on FAC.

    There was a PCP equivalent made by someone, who's name escapes me. This was a 9mm and was basically a large bore standard PCP 'rifle'.
